## Authentication

Quick note for the sync: the Pellamy load balancer now requires auth on `/healthz`, because the old open endpoint leaked build metadata. Probes from the balancer get a static credential injected at deploy time. If you're curling the check by hand, use the bearer token below.

session JWT of yawep-yawep = eyJhbGciOiJIUzI1NiIsInR5cCI6IkpXVCJ9.eyJzdWIiOiI3pWF3_In0.aXYsHiog

Subject: Transfer of responsibilities — Prismgate transcoding farm. As of next Monday, operational ownership of the Prismgate video transcoding farm, including credential management, worker provisioning, and incident response, moves from the Media Platform group to the Infrastructure Reliability group. All pending security review items should be redirected accordingly. Going forward, the accountable owner for security sign-offs is the person named below.

account owner for fajep-yagef: Kasix Eliiel

Action item (sev-2 follow-up): the Pellgrove warehouse scanner integration accepted malformed barcode payloads, triggering retry storms against the intake service. Fix ships input validation and rate caps at the gateway. Security review requested on the validation regexes and the failure-mode logging, which now redacts raw payloads. Rollout is staged per site. The rate and retry constants being deployed are listed below.

tuning table, yajog-yahof:
BUDGETS = {
    "lamvan": 303,
    "wenox": 460,
    "fenvan": 525,
}